The generalized mean-square amplitudes of vibration and mean amplitudes of vibration have been computed for CrO3-4, Mn18O-4, MoSe2-4 and WSe2-4 ions at three temperatures, T = 0°K, T = 298°K, T = 500°K, employing Cyvin's method. The results have been discussed in the light of atomic weight and electronegativity of the atom in the ionic system. 相似文献

Applicability of the nitromethane selective quenching rule for discriminating between alternant versus nonalternant polycyclic
aromatic hydrocarbons (PAHs) is examined for 20 representative PAH solutes dissolved in micellar sodium dodecylsulfate (SDS)
+ cetyltrimethylammonium bromide (CTAB), SDS + dodecyltrimethylammonium bromide (DTAB), SDS + Brij-35, and SDS + sodium octanoate
(SO) mixed surfactant solvent media. Experimental results show that nitromethane quenched fluorescence of all 8 alternant
PAHs studied in the four different solvent systems. Unexpected quenching behavior was observed, however, in the case of nonalternant
PAHs. Nitromethane quenched fluorescence emission of nonalternant PAHs dissolved in the SDS + SO solvent media, which is contrary
to the selective quenching rule. In the case of the mixed anionic + cationic surfactant solvent media, nitromethane quenching
selectivity was restored at concentration ratios of approximately 4 : 1 (anionic:cationic) or less.

Various new structural entities related to x-azatricyclo[m.n.0. 0(a)()(,)(b)()]alkanes are constructed by the intramolecular [3 + 2] dipolar cycloaddition of nonstabilized cyclic azomethine ylides. The ylide is generated by the sequential double desilylation of N-alkyl alpha,alpha'-bis(trimethylsilyl)cyclic amines using Ag(I)F as a one-electron oxidant. 相似文献

Densities,ρ, ultrasonic speeds, u, viscosities,η, and refractive indices, n, of pure benzene, benzyl alcohol (BA), benzonitrile (BN), benzoyl chloride (BC), chlorobenzene (CB) and their thirty six binary mixtures, with benzene as common component, were measured at 303.15 K over the entire mole fraction range. From these experimental data the values of deviations in ultrasonic speed, △u, isentropic compressibility, △ks,excess acoustic impedance, ZE, deviation in viscosity, Dh, and excess Gibbs free energy of activation of viscous flow, G*E, and partial molar isentropic compressibility, Kφ,20 of BA, BN, BC and CB in benzene were computed. The variation of these derived functions with composition of the mixtures suggested the increased cohesion
(molecular order) in the solution and that interaction (A-B)>(A-A) or (B-B).Moreover, theoretical prediction of ultrasonic speed, viscosity and refractive index of all the four binary mixtures was made on the basis of empirical and semi-empirical relations by using the experimental values of the pure components. Comparison of theoretical results with the experimental values was made in order to assess the suitability of these relations in reproducing the
experimental values of u, η and n. Also, molecular radii of pure liquids and the average molecular radii of binary mixtures were evaluated using the corresponding refractive indices of pure liquids and binary mixtures. The average molecular radii of binary mixtures were found to be additive with respect to mole fraction of the pure component. 相似文献

The reactions of bis(cyclopentadienyl)titanium(IV)/zirconium(IV) dichloride with a new class of organometallic thiosemicarbazones (LH), derived by condensing acetylferrocene with substituted thiosemicarbazides, have been studied and two types of bimetallic products, viz. [Cp2M(L)Cl] (M = Ti or Zr) and [CpZr(L)3], have been isolated. On the basis of various physicochemical and spectral studies, five- and seven-coordinate structures have been assigned to these derivatives, respectively. Attempts have been made to establish a correlation between biological activity and the structures of the products. 相似文献
